Benz drives in Edition C

November 12, 2013 05:07 pm | Updated 10:59 pm IST - Mumbai

Eberhard Kern, MD and CEO, Mercedes-Benz India, poses with the new Edition C car at its launch in Mumbai on Tuesday.

Mercedes-Benz India, to celebrate the sale of 10 million cars of the C Class family, has introduced ‘Edition C’, a sporty and stylish car priced at Rs. 39.16 lakh (ex-showroom, Mumbai). A limited number of 500 units would be available.

“The C-Class remains one of Merc’s best-sellers in the competitive entry-level luxury sedan segment. ‘Edition C’ with its dynamic and sporty exterior, specially designed luxurious interiors, innovative engineering and impressive efficiency is an inspiring car and will continue to set newer benchmarks in design, quality and luxury for the segment,” Eberhard Kern, CEO, Mercedes-Benz India, said.
